Distribution Work Planning & Process Coordinator, FTT (P3)

Number of positions: 1 Job Location: Edmonds A03

Employment type: Temporary Region: Lower Mainland

Hours of work: Full-time (37.5 hrs/wk) Flexible Work Role: Hybrid

Annual salary: $ 103,900.00 - 131,400.00

What you'll do

Distribution Asset Sustainment and Maintenance (DASM) has a challenging and exciting opportunity for a highly motivated
individual with demonstrated and proven communication, leadership, and cross functional relationship building skills to join
the team as a Distribution Planning and Process Coordinator at BC Hydro's Edmonds office in Burnaby, BC or an
alternative BC Hydro office depending on space availability and/or the current location of the successful candidate.
The successful candidate will have the necessary skills and is or will become a Subject Matter Expert in BC Hydro’s
Geospatial Information System (GIS), Spatial Asset Management (SAM), Steady State System (SSS), Maintenance Design
Tracking System (MDTS), and Passport and SAP Work Management systems as well as other applications that are used to
manage various distribution line assets and work programs.
Duties will include but are not limited to the following:
  • Assists DASM Program Engineers with development, presentation and update of Distribution Maintenance Standards and
Bulletins, Asset Health Indices, Asset Strategies, Annual Plans and 10 Year Plans.
  • Leads development and maintenance of business processes, business rules, and financial accounting for DASM work
programs in SAM, SSS, MDTS, Passport, SAP and other systems.
  • Works with DASM Program Engineers and Program and Contract Management (PCM) staff to establish the queries and
work templates to develop the annual and quarterly work packages for DASM, PCB and Asbestos work programs before
and during the fiscal year.
  • Uses, loads, and leads maintenance and enhancement of SAM, SSS, MDTS, Passport, SAP and any other business
applications required for DASM, PCB and Asbestos work programs.
  • Leads the review of monthly work program progress as reported by PCM. Reports on progress of the long term work plan
including progress in addressing work backlogs. Explains and reports on overall and high level variances to the
Maintenance and End of Life Capital work programs based on detailed input from PCM.
  • Quality checks GIS, SAM, SSS, MDTS, Passport, and SAP data to ensure entries, data and charging for work programs
are complete and accurate.
  • Departmental Subject Matter Expert (SME) for SAM and member of SAM Technical Working Group.

  • SME for querying/reporting/analysing SAM/GIS data and developing SAM work templates for work programs.

  • Departmental SME for BC Hydro’s Distribution Analysis and Design (DAD) and member of DAD Technical Working Group.

  • Ensures GIS data model changes coordinate and align with Asset Planning business goals

  • Produces monthly reports for outstanding SAM Action Requests and Data Corrections

  • Manages graffiti policy, annual graffiti grants to municipalities and the ad hoc escalation in graffiti complaints from the
public.
  • Acts as advisor and BC Hydro representative for Legal claims pertaining to maintenance and replacement of assets on the
distribution system.

What you bring

  • Minimum 8 years knowledge and experience in the design, maintenance and/or construction of an electrical utility
distribution system.
  • Possesses a Diploma of Technology, Bachelor’s Degree or proven work experience directly related to the duties of this
position*.
  • Ongoing development such as self-study, attendance at technical and administrative courses and participation in technical
and professional societies. Certificates required as evidence of continued professional development.
  • Excellent communication, technical writing, interpersonal and presentation skills.

  • Proficient in using enterprise business systems including work management and GIS applications. This includes but is not
limited to SAP and Passport Work Management systems and GE Smallworld GIS applications or equivalent.
  • The preferred candidate would also have: experience in the design and development of maintenance standards and
developing innovative techniques for maintaining overhead and/or underground distribution infrastructure and equipment;
the ability to perform technical research and provide reliable advice on difficult problems which can augment the
departmental mandate; the ability to prepare and interpret engineering plans and specifications; strong knowledge of
industry standards and a keen asset management business acumen; and experience in risk and hazard evaluation.
  • Proficient in using Microsoft Office and various database applications.
